In a limiting reactant problem, we start with a certain amount of each reactant, but what happens to the excess reactant? In this video, we go step by step to determine how much of the excess reactant is left over after the reaction.

🔹 Find the Limiting Reactant – The limiting reactant determines how much of the excess reactant will be used. We compare mole ratios to identify it.
🔹 Calculate How Much Excess Reactant is Used – Using a proportion, we determine how much of the excess reactant reacts completely.
🔹 Subtract to Find What’s Left – By subtracting the amount used from the starting amount, we find how much of the excess reactant remains.
